Company Overview: Founded in the family basement in 1939, Zoeller Pump Company is one of the oldest family-owned water pump manufacturers in North America. Headquartered in Louisville, KY, we proudly excel with fourth-generation leadership and an expanding workforce. Over the past seven decades, our company has established itself as a dependable leader in the wastewater industry. Through continuous research and development, we are always improving our products and processes to provide the highest possible quality to our loyal customers and end users. This dependability is backed by a family commitment to add value for our customers and provide genuine support before, during, and after a sale. Job Summary: Zoeller Pump Company is seeking a dedicated and skilled Applications Engineer with experience in the wastewater industry.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in wastewater engineering, a passion for providing innovative solutions, and a commitment to excellence in their work. This role will involve working closely with the quotations department to ensure accurate and competitive pricing for clients, streamlining the proposal process, and providing timely responses to customer inquiries. EIT certification with aspirations to become PE certified is preferred. Key Responsibilities: Responsible for performing hydraulic analysis, design, and specification of components and assemblies for Low Pressure Sewer (LPS), commercial and municipal pump systems. Perform cost analyses and provide submittals for commercial and municipal jobs. Contribute to the development and improvement of municipal collection and treatment systems and/or on-site wastewater systems. Work closely with Quotations department to solve technical problems and provide timely responses to customer inquiries.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ure product quality and performance. Qualifications: Bachelor’s degree in Civil or Mechanical Engineering. Minimum of 1-2 years of engineering experience; experience with pumps, municipal collection and treatment systems and/or on-site wastewater systems is a plus. EIT certified with strong aspirations of becoming PE certified.
